Windows is understood as Microsoft Windows, affectionately also referred to as just Windows or Win, it is an operating system equipped with a graphical interface !Developed and published by Microsoft, Windows has been constantly expanding and improving since the first Microsoft Windows version launched in 1983 with version 1.0. The current version is Windows 11/10, Microsoft chose “Windows” as the name due to the multiple windows that allow different tasks and programs to run simultaneously/in parallel.
The latest Windows 11 has many new features that were first introduced with Windows 8, in addition some of the main features have been completely revised and rethought!
Beginning with Windows XP, Microsoft has released different editions of Windows. Each of these MS Windows editions has the same operating core, but the higher editions have additional features. The two most popular editions of Windows for home computers are Windows Home and Windows Professional.
